Q1: What is the company name and its meaning?
A1: The company name is Cent'anni Jewelry, which translates to "Hundred Years" in Italian. This name is an Italian toast that wishes a hundred years of health.
Q2: Who is the founder of Cent'anni Jewelry?
A2: The founder of Cent'anni Jewelry is Lisa Gifford, who has been designing custom pieces for her clients since 2017.
